The Lepi (Lepus carnivorus) were a species of sentient rabbit, ranging in color from green to dark blue, or white. Their most distinctive features were long ears and feet and buck teeth. Native to the Coachelle system. The Lepus carnivorus were typically gregarious individuals, although prone to bursts of anger if they felt insulted. Lepi were constantly in motion and were known for their speed.

Special Abilities
Feet of Fury
A Lepi’s feet make effective weapons. Lepi who use their feet to make brawling: kicking attacks get +2 to hit, and add +2 to any damage they inflict. In addition Lepi add +1ᴅ to any climbing/jumping skill rolls they make that involve jumps.
Alertness
Due to their keen sight and hearing, Lepi characters get a +2 pip bonus to search rolls.
